Transaction 0621bdfa030d37601255691193fe8c77a6746179ed6619aa7d70d65f00f6ab4f

1 Input
2 Outputs
  • 0621bdfa030d37601255691193fe8c77a6746179ed6619aa7d70d65f00f6ab4f:0
  • value  18000000
    address  3C37azDhqfX4eeRiwF2oUrG9K5iv9esBXd
  • 0621bdfa030d37601255691193fe8c77a6746179ed6619aa7d70d65f00f6ab4f:1
  • value  20031604
    address  14geJnwo8SaNkiPixkV5Aih6obMtCxi6ZR